Netflix has started rolling out a ‘Mobile+’ plan in India, priced at Rs 349, as reported by AndroidPure.
With the new plan of Netflix, you can stream HD content on mobile, tablet, and computer screens, according to the report.
But, you CAN NOT Stream on TV.

Moreover, Netflix also confirmed the news in an emailed statement:
“We launched the mobile plan in India to make it easier for anyone with a smartphone to enjoy Netflix. We want to see if members like the added choice this offer brings. We’ll only roll it out long-term if they do.”
Netflix said that it is only testing the plan in India, currently and will only roll out the plan to all after a ‘long-term’ testing.

Last year in July, Netflix had launched it’s first Rs 199 mobile-only subscription plan in India. The plan added to its Rs 499 basic plan, Rs 649 standard plan, and Rs 799 premium plan in India.
